1. Introduction In recent years, Japanese society has been suffering from aging. There have been many studies estimating the number of elderly people living alone will be increasing frighteningly. Moreover, patients who suffered from senile dementia also would be increasing. In 2025, we estimated the number of elderly people with dementia would be increased to 7 million1 . Dementia is disorder of memory and judgment caused by dying brain cell. Therefore, patients suffering from dementia are unable to live with ordinary social life. If dementia has been detected at an early stage, the progress of disease can be slowed. Therefore, early detection of dementia is essential to the patient’s therapy. Usually, housemates can detect dementia by noticing the subject being temperamental person. However, it is difficult to diagnose dementia at an early stage of the progression in elderly subjects living alone. 1.1. Previous Study and Tasks In our previous study, the authors proposed system which can detect a suspicion of Alzheimer’s disease, a kind of dementia, at an early stage 2-4. This system installed sensors inside the house of elderly people living alone. Sensors detected behaviors by initial symptoms, and then these data were sent to a database in cloud server. The system analyzed sensors’ data in the cloud and determined the suspicion of dementia. However, the system used preselected sensors and analytical methods to determine the suspicion of dementia for instance. Alzheimer’s disease is individually different in case of dealing with initial symptoms. Therefore, we need to add various types of sensors and select proper analytical methods to detect the symptoms. Moreover, the system hasn’t constructed a platform that can be modified easily when we want to increase the number of the subjects and add analytical method. 1.2. Purpose In this study, we proposed a platform of M2M system. The system can add new sensors and use a variety of analytical methods to correspond a variety of characteristics of Alzheimer’s disease patients by using a hierarchical configuration of the device, gateway and cloud. Furthermore, we examined division of functions about device, gateway and cloud in the signal processing, such as characteristic of amount extraction. As an example, we have developed a detection system about forgetting to close a faucet that is seen in early stage of Alzheimer’s disease by using M2M Platform.
